Twilight Hutterite Colony (Falher, Alberta, Canada)
Twilight Hutterite Colony near Falher, Alberta, was founded in 1986 as a division from the MacMillan Hutterite Colony. In 2012 the Twilight Hutterite Colony was aLehrerleut colony. The minister was Sam M. Entz and the manager was Paul M. Wipf.
